A wet basement rarely starts with one dramatic event. More often, it begins with a damp corner after heavy rain, a white chalky residue on the wall, or a musty smell that never quite goes away. When homeowners compare interior vs exterior waterproofing, the right choice comes down to a straightforward question: Are you managing water after it reaches the foundation, or stopping it before it gets there?
Both approaches can protect a home, and both have a place in a proper repair plan. The best solution depends on the source of the moisture, the condition of the foundation, the layout of the property, and what you want from the basement long term.
Exterior waterproofing addresses water at the outside of the foundation. A crew excavates along the affected foundation walls, exposes the concrete or masonry, cleans the surface, repairs visible cracks where needed, and applies a waterproof barrier. A drainage system may also be installed or improved at the footing level to carry groundwater away from the home.
This is the closest thing to stopping water at its source. When soil becomes saturated after prolonged rain or snowmelt, hydrostatic pressure builds against below-grade walls. That pressure can force water through cracks, joints, porous concrete, and openings around utility penetrations. Exterior waterproofing reduces the amount of water that reaches those vulnerable areas.
For Illinois homes with persistent leakage along one exterior wall, deteriorated foundation coatings, or major drainage issues, exterior work can be the most complete repair. It is also often the better option when a foundation wall needs crack repair from the outside or when water is contributing to structural deterioration.
Exterior waterproofing is especially valuable when the problem involves more than a finished basement floor getting wet. It may be the right path when you see bowing or damaged walls, soil grading that directs water toward the foundation, failed exterior drainage, or water entering through a known crack below grade.
It also makes sense during other outside projects. If landscaping, patios, sidewalks, or exterior foundation repairs are already being addressed, the additional access can make an exterior waterproofing repair more practical.
The trade-off is excavation. Digging around a foundation takes more labor, equipment, and restoration work than an interior drainage installation. Gardens, shrubs, decks, driveways, and walkways may need to be removed, protected, or repaired afterward. Not every home has enough access for excavation equipment, either.
Interior waterproofing controls water that reaches the foundation and directs it safely away before it can damage the living space. In most basement systems, the contractor opens a narrow section of the concrete floor around the perimeter, installs a drainage channel or perforated pipe, adds clean stone, and connects the system to a sump basin and pump. The floor is then restored.
Water entering through the wall-floor joint, small wall cracks, or the soil beneath the slab is collected by the system and discharged away from the home. A vapor barrier may also be installed on foundation walls to guide moisture down into the drainage system and improve the appearance of the space.
This method does not usually prevent groundwater from contacting the exterior foundation wall. Instead, it relieves the pressure and gives water a controlled path out of the basement. That distinction matters, but it does not make interior waterproofing a lesser solution. For many basements, it is the most reliable and cost-effective way to keep the space dry.
Interior drainage is often the preferred solution for recurring seepage at the cove joint, water coming up through the basement floor, or widespread moisture issues where exterior excavation would be disruptive or impractical. It is also well suited to homes with tight property lines, finished landscaping, attached garages, or concrete surfaces that would be expensive to remove and replace.
Installation is typically completed from inside the basement, which means the crew can work in most weather conditions without disturbing the outside of the property. For homeowners planning to finish a basement, an interior drainage system with a dependable sump pump provides a practical layer of protection before framing, flooring, and drywall go in.
Its success depends on proper design and installation. The drainage path must be continuous, the discharge line must carry water safely away, and the pump must be sized and maintained for the home’s conditions. A battery backup can be a wise addition in areas where storms and power outages happen together.
The most useful way to compare these methods is by looking at the problem they solve. Exterior waterproofing is preventive at the wall surface. It blocks or redirects water before it penetrates the foundation. Interior waterproofing is corrective and protective. It captures water that reaches the foundation system and removes it from the basement.
Exterior systems generally require a larger upfront investment because of excavation and landscape restoration. Interior systems are often more affordable and less invasive, particularly when the issue affects several walls or the entire perimeter. However, the lower-cost option is not automatically the right option if a wall has exterior cracks, visible deterioration, or structural concerns that require direct outside access.
There is also a difference in how each approach affects your property during installation. Exterior work may involve temporary disruption to landscaping and hardscaping. Interior work creates controlled dust and requires access to the basement, but it normally leaves the yard intact. An experienced contractor will explain what needs to be moved, how the work area will be protected, and what restoration is included before the project begins.
Sometimes, choosing between two methods is the wrong goal. Homes with serious water management issues may benefit from both exterior improvements and interior protection.
For example, poor grading, short downspout extensions, clogged gutters, and negative drainage near the home can send unnecessary water toward the foundation. Correcting those conditions reduces the workload on any waterproofing system. If groundwater still reaches the basement during extended wet periods, an interior drainage system can provide the dependable backup needed to keep the space usable.
Likewise, a foundation wall with a significant exterior crack may need outside repair and waterproofing, while an interior perimeter system handles broader groundwater pressure. A combined plan is not about selling more work. It is about matching each repair to the way water is moving around your specific home.
A small amount of moisture can create larger problems if it is ignored. Watch for dampness after rain, puddles near walls, peeling paint, rusting appliances, mold growth, musty odors, efflorescence, or a sump pump that runs constantly. Water stains that seem to dry out are still evidence that moisture has found a path into the basement.
Foundation symptoms deserve attention as well. Horizontal or stair-step cracks, wall movement, sticking doors, and gaps near windows can point to pressure or settlement that goes beyond basic waterproofing. Water control and foundation repair are closely connected, so the condition of the structure should be evaluated before a waterproofing plan is finalized.
A professional inspection should identify where water is entering, whether the issue is surface water or groundwater, the condition of the foundation, and the practical repair options. Be cautious of one-size-fits-all recommendations. A trustworthy contractor should be able to explain why a particular system fits the evidence in your home.
The right waterproofing system is the one that addresses the actual cause of the problem while respecting your home, property, and budget. Interior drainage may be the efficient answer for a wet basement floor. Exterior waterproofing may be necessary when water is damaging the foundation from the outside. In many cases, better drainage around the home makes either solution work even better.
